Translate the verbal phrase: 5 plus the quotient of x and 15.

A) 5 + (x - 15)
B) 5 + 15
C) 5 + 1/5
D) 5 - 15 = 2

Final answer:

The verbal phrase '5 plus the quotient of x and 15' translates to the mathematical expression 5 + (x / 15), which is not listed in the provided options. The given choices do not accurately represent the phrase.

Step-by-step explanation:

The verbal phrase '5 plus the quotient of x and 15' can be translated into a mathematical expression. The word 'plus' indicates addition, while 'the quotient of x and 15' indicates division between x and 15. Therefore, the correct translation of the phrase is 5 added to the result of x divided by 15.

The correct mathematical expression for this verbal phrase is therefore:

5 + (x / 15)

However, this option is not provided in the choices given. If we must choose from the provided options, none of them correctly represents the phrase. The closest incorrect option provided in the list is 5 + (x - 15), but it incorrectly uses subtraction instead of division.
